Ride the Ducks

Ride the Ducks is a duck tour operator, and an eponymous tourist attraction in US cities such as Baltimore, Branson, Memphis and Philadelphia. It makes use of amphibious vehicles ("ducks") to provide tours of cities by boat and by land. Several such services have sprung up in recent years in other major cities including Boston, Portland, and Toronto.

The actual vehicle is based on the famous WWII DUKW amphibious design (see post-war use). Today, the company builds its vehicles from the ground up to incorporate advances in marine design and safety.

Ride the Ducks supported rescue and evacuation efforts in New Orleans following Hurricane Katrina. They volunteered equipment, crew, and other resources in order to help evacuate residents of the hardest-hit areas. The volunteering team was deemed "invaluable" by those involved in the rescue effort, as the ducks were able to safely access areas inaccessible by other means.
